Here’s how I typically do a single shot BR gun. I do it because our single shot extractors are at 11:30 and 1:30. Not your typical 3&9 so it’s very evident if the slots aren’t dead nuts. There is some drawback as the chamber mouth is easily dinged, but that can be overcome with some firing pin massaging.
The other picture is how I do 100% of the repeaters. The extractor slots are at 3 & 9 so it’s easy to just move the extractor slot cutter over to the other side of the barrel.
